Manela Glarcher is a Researcher at the Institute of Nursing Science and Practice. Her work focuses on strengthening healthcare quality and patient safety, particularly in advanced nursing practice and complex intervention development. She holds roles such as Deputy Director of the WHO Collaborating Centre for Nursing Research and Education (since 2022) and Honorary Fellow at the University of Wollongong (since 2021). Her research interests include patient safety, outcome measures, and nursing competencies in anesthesia and palliative care.
Glarcher has led and contributed to multiple projects, including studies on advanced practice nurses' roles in Austria and Australia. She has published extensively on topics like nurse practitioner sustainability, safety climate in hospitals, and ethical challenges in tele-palliative care. Her work aligns with UN Sustainable Development Goals related to health equity and quality education.
Her scientific achievements include four awards, notably the Research & Innovation Award for best first-author publication. Glarcher also serves in editorial roles for journals like BMC Nursing and Contemporary Nurse, and actively engages in peer-review and academic hosting activities.
Key research projects include investigating nurse shortages' impact on patient safety during pandemics, developing safety climate surveys in Austrian hospitals, and analyzing competency frameworks for advanced practice nurses in anesthesia. She collaborates internationally, emphasizing nurse education's role in fostering just culture and safety-focused practice.
